单词 ponce
释义

W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024
ponce  (pons),USA pronunciation n. [Brit. Slang.]
  1. British Termsa pimp.
  2. British Termsa campily effeminate male.
  • of obscure origin, originally 1870–75

Pon•ce  (pônse),USA pronunciation n. 
  1. Place Namesa seaport in S Puerto Rico. 161,739.

Collins Concise English Dictionary © HarperCollins Publishers::
ponce /pɒns/ derogatory slang chiefly Brit n
  1. a man given to ostentatious or effeminate display in manners, speech, dress, etc
  2. another word for pimp1
vb
  1. (intr; often followed by around or about) to act like a ponce
Etymology: 19th Century: from Polari, from Spanish pu(n)to male prostitute or French pront prostitute
Collins Concise English Dictionary © HarperCollins Publishers::
Ponce /Spanish: ˈpɔnθe/ n
  1. a port in S Puerto Rico, on the Caribbean: the second largest town on the island; settled in the 16th century. Pop: 185 930 (2003 est)
